Registration Statement
A set of documents filed with a regulatory body, such as the SEC, detailing the particulars of a new security to be issued to the public.
Statute of Limitations
Legislation that specifies the longest duration allowed to initiate legal action, varying by the nature of the claim or case.
Private Offering
A method of raising capital through the sale of securities to a relatively small number of selected investors as opposed to a public offering.
Registration Provisions
Legal rules and guidelines that outline the requirements for officially recording certain types of documents, activities, or entities with authorities.
